Summary: Seeking a Systems Engineer to lead and support requirements development, system architecture, and design documentation for defense projects.
Bachelor's degree in engineering with 6+ years of relevant experience
Experience in systems engineering, including requirements evaluation and allocation
Proficiency in developing architecture concepts and evaluating alternatives
Knowledge of balancing system design with CONOPS, performance, constraints, and logistics
Ability to plan, conduct, and document complex trade studies
Experience generating System/Subsystem Design Descriptions per program requirements
Logical architecture experience with use case development
Proficiency in Model Based Systems Engineering (MBSE) using SysML and tools like Cameo
Familiarity with Department of Defense Architecture Framework (DoDAF)
Experience with DOORS requirements management tool
INCOSE Certified Systems Engineering Professional (CSEP) certification required
Responsibilities:
Spearhead or assist in requirements development and management
Develop subsystem/component performance specifications by evaluating necessary requirements
Maintain requirements verification and compliance artifacts
Support analysis for concept architectures and system characteristics development
Facilitate architecture development of assigned systems/subsystems/components
Drive interface requirements/design information for subsystems/systems/components
Document concept design selections; generate System/Subsystem Design Descriptions (SSDDs)
Coordinate formal decisions/trade studies; document results
Support cost, schedule, risk monitoring/actualization
Influence design through coordinating Systems Engineering activities
Participate in vehicle-level Systems Engineering activities/program milestone reviews
